Putin to take part in Kazakh, Belarusian presidents’ meeting in Astana

Kazakh authorities are waiting for Russian President Vladimir Putin's visit in March to Astana, where they will host his meeting with the leaders of Kazakhstan and Belarus, RIA Novosti reported Feb. 26.

Earlier, the Kremlin's press service said that Putin and Kazakhstan's President Nursultan Nazarbayev discussed on the phone the issues of international assistance to the peaceful settlement of the crisis in Ukraine.

"At the end of the conversation, Putin confirmed his intention to take part in a tripartite meeting of the presidents of Kazakhstan, Belarus and Russia, which is scheduled to be held in March in Astana," the press service of the Kazakh president said.
